Job summary
The Department is looking to recruit a Health Records Clerk to work as part of a team of clerks that retrieve notes from the records library, prepare them for outpatient clinics or in-patient admissions and ensure that they are tracked and monitored correctly throughout the Trusts hospital sites.
Fixed Term Post for 12 months
Main duties of the job
The work requires the lifting, carrying and moving of paper-based records throughout each day, some of which are stored at floor level and others may be on higher shelves only accessible with stools or ladders. Collections of records and boxes may be heavy (up to 10kg). Records are stored in an extensive library and need to be located, processed and returned accurately and quickly.
About us
The Healthcare Records Department is responsible for the management, storage and provision of records for all outpatient clinics and admitted patients at Andover War Memorial Hospital, Basingstoke and North Hampshire Hospital and Royal Hampshire County Hospital, Winchester.
